About

Access and control your Mac, Windows, or Linux PC from any location. This app offers a secure and reliable way to manage your computer remotely, whether for work, updates, or assisting others.

External keyboard, mouse, and trackpad support
Curtain Mode for privacy
Secure SSH and Remote Login connections
Connect from anywhere with Screens Connect
Powerful gestures and shortcuts toolbar
Display selection for multi-monitor setups
Clipboard sharing and synchronization

Doesn’t Support Click + Hold

Screens has a beautifully designed simple interface, with a very user friendly network setup process. Unfortunately, it’s still lacking some basic features for remote computing. The app does not support right or middle mouse button click + hold commands, rendering softwares like Rhino, AutoCad, Revit, or the Adobe CS suite virtually unusable when remoting into a desktop. I’d consider revisiting this app once the developer team has addressed this basic interface, but if your in the AEC or design industries, stick with the laptop for now.

FAQ

What does Screens: VNC Remote Desktop do?

This application allows you to remotely access and control your Mac, Windows, or Linux computer from your mobile device. You can perform tasks like working on documents, updating software, or troubleshooting issues on your computer as if you were sitting in front of it.

What are the key features of this remote desktop app?

Key features include support for external keyboards and trackpads, a privacy-focused Curtain Mode, secure connection options like SSH, the ability to connect from anywhere with Screens Connect, powerful gestures, a customizable shortcuts toolbar, and clipboard sharing.
